Roof terrace door — Penrose Building, night shift. The door jams; known issue, ticket open with Corvid Maintenance. Do not force it. Lift the handle slightly, then push. Check it has latched behind you on every patrol; it often fails to close fully. If it won't open at all, use the stairwell bypass keypad with the code below.

door code, yagap-bahof: bdg-O-05

**Ticket: DeployBuddy signature check failing on status replies**

Hey, quick one for review: DeployBuddy (our deploy-status chat bot) started rejecting webhook payloads from the Quillhaven pipeline last night. The HMAC check fails on every message, so the bot just posts "unverified" and stays silent. I traced it to the rotation on Tuesday — the bot is still pinned to the old key. Fix is in the branch; to verify locally, use the new key below.

signing key of bagap-yawep = bky13_TbfT6ZMUoGJo2

- [ ] **Step 7: Breaker override escrow.** After sealing the signing keys for the Tallgrove upstream API circuit breaker, confirm the support team can force the breaker open during a full outage. The override bundle lives in the sealed escrow drawer and is useless without its unlock phrase. Two ceremony witnesses must initial this step before proceeding. The escrow bundle is decrypted with the recovery passphrase that follows.

vault phrase of kahip-kahop = holath-quenmir

Ticket #4417 — Pop-Up Office, Larkspur Trade Fair

A temporary office unit for the Mistral Forge team will operate in Hall B of the Larkspur Exhibition Grounds from Tuesday through Friday. Reception staff rotating through the pop-up should collect the event lanyard from the hall steward each morning and return it at close. The unit's rear storage cabin holds demo equipment and must stay locked when unattended. The cabin keypad is set to the code below.

badge for fafop-fajof: bdg-Z-47

The garage occupancy feed for the Brindlewood campus arrives over a message queue every thirty seconds, one record per level, published by the Stallgrid edge boxes. Counts can briefly go negative when a sensor double-fires on exit; the ingest job clamps these to zero and flags the interval. If the feed stalls for more than five minutes, the dashboard falls back to the last known snapshot. Sensor mappings, queue names, and the replay procedure are documented on the internal page below.

runbook for tahog-kadug: https://gitlab.qirvanworks.corp/projects/pages/view/b139298aed28